Segai, also known as Punan Kelai, is a Kayanic language spoken in several communities along the Kelai River, Berau Regency, East Kalimantan, Indonesia.[2]

Phonology

[edit]

Consonants

[edit]
Consonant phonemes of Punan Kelai[3]
Labial Alveolar Palatal Velar Glottal
Nasal m n ɲ ŋ
Plosive voiceless p t c k ʔ
voiced b d ɟ ɡ
Fricative s h
Liquid l, r
Glide w

Vowels

[edit]
Vowel phonemes of Punan Kelai[3]
Front Central Back
Close i u
Mid e, ɛ ə o
Open æ a ɒ

Diphthongs also occur as [iw, ew, æw, əw], [ao̯, ai̯, ae̯], [uj, oj].
